A gulf is a large inlet from the ocean into the landmass, typically with a narrower opening than a bay, but that is not observable in all geographic areas so named. Wikipedia
Large inlet that is an arm of an ocean or sea Wikidata
A portion of an ocean or sea extending into the land; a partially landlocked sea. Wiktionary
